Origins of the Trabulsi Surname

The surname 'Trabulsi' is of Arabic origin, and it is believed to have originated from the Middle East. The name 'Trabulsi' is thought to be derived from the Arabic word 'tarablus,' which means 'Tripoli' in reference to the city in Lebanon. Thus, the surname 'Trabulsi' likely originated from individuals who were associated with or hailed from Tripoli in Lebanon.

Brazil

In Brazil, the surname 'Trabulsi' has also gained popularity, with a significant number of individuals bearing this surname. The Brazilian Trabulsi families are often descendants of Lebanese immigrants who settled in Brazil and brought their culture and traditions with them.
